Foxtable(狐表)用户栏目专家坐堂 → 数据参照完整性如何实现?


  共有5210人关注过本帖平板打印复制链接

主题:数据参照完整性如何实现?

帅哥哟,离线,有人找我吗?
zpx_2012
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:976 积分:8527 威望:0 精华:0 注册:2012/2/9 16:35:00
数据参照完整性如何实现?  发帖心情 Post By:2013/11/28 10:37:00 [只看该作者]

系统中有一个{产品编码}表,订单明细,出入库明细,采购明细等都是从中提取产品编码的相关数据自动填充,现在想实现当修改产品编码中的产品编码时所有引用表中的产品编码自动更新,如果删除产品编码时该编码被任何一张单据引用便禁止删除并提示。
本想在sql数据库关系图中设置一对多的关系,但因为全部主键都是用的[_Identify]用它连接无意义。不知道这种情况下(主键是_Identify)怎么才能用产品编码建立多个表之间的一对多关系?

图片点击可在新窗口打开查看此主题相关图片如下:20131128-1.jpg
图片点击可在新窗口打开查看

如果不用sql关系图,在ft中如何实现这种功能(不会是要在删除或更新产品编码时遍历后台所有表去逐个查找吧?这样速度肯定是个大问题)

谢谢!


 回到顶部